Wow..lots of really nasty weather out of Hudson last Sunday...

We made it to a reef in 20' for bait and all this, includidng the waterspouts popped up south of us. Looked good West, so off we ran.

Lot's of bait schools, and the bite was on pretty good. Gags, reds and cobia were all available as well as a couple of big sharks. Cindy and I both had good hookups and both were cut off at the boat..

We came home with the cobia, a couple of gags and a nice red...all in all a great day on the water.

Interesting- I don't see many posts about Hudson. I spent two vacations there in a house I rented on a canal down there. Took my boat both times and spent the week wandering around the area. Funny to go 20 miles offshore, beyond the site of land and only be in 30' of water...
I had a terrible time trying to find the reef piles out there- seems like they were about the size of a dinner table in my opinion- I'd see it on the graph and then nothing- shouldn't have been that hard.
I did manage to fins one area with nice returns and lots of marks. Set the rods out and in 5 minutes we caught two big triggers and a grunt. Had something hit that was pulling so hard I couldn't get the rod out of the holder- it bent the tip nearly to the water before the 60# leader snapped. Shark? Probably. Massive gag grouper? That's what I decided it MUST have been. LOL
Loved the area though. Fillman's Bayou was full of reds and sea trout and jacks and we caught a ton. Lots of fun.
The cabins out in the water were cool! Never saw those before. We loved Anclote as well- beautiful place to play.
